                            I have to say I used to hate the whoring a good team could do in a Blackhawk, until I really thought about how to take them down. Occasionally I dedicate myself a whole round just to this purpose - six kills a pop is worth the loss of my life a few times trying.

                            That MEC/Chinese buggy with the 360 degree traverse heavy MG is a Blackhawk killer. Only if they have dedicated engineers repairing will you need others adding some additional fire. Position yourself with some thought and they wont even see you - under their belly at point blank range is satisfying, or off under a tree somewhere away from all the ground action...remember they can't see anything below them, behind them, and only the pilot can see in front. They can't afford to sit still in the sky looking for your ground fire, lest they become easy targets for missiles. At the very least I find I can reliably drive them off flags, if I am prepared. Give some thought to where they are going. Note their direction, look at the map, and spawn in anticipation of their route and your knowledge of anti-air assets. Blackhawks tend to look for easy flag targets.

                            As soldiers on the ground we have to think when there is a good Blackhawk crew up. Spawning at flags they are hovering over is asking to be eaten for breakfast. How quickly can you die? ;-)

                            There is nothing better than seeing a full Blackhawk on fire, trying desperately to get away....they are so slow! Watching bodies tumbling from the interior as they come under sustained heavy fire is most satisfying too.
                            Stingers are also very effective against them, especially I find at medium and long ranges. The best crews can lock down stinger sites with a hail of lead at short range...
                            I agree with the guy who suggested maybe they need to take longer taking flags (or touching down).. and perhaps changing the generous point sharing for crews, but that is about all. If more people remembered this is war in three dimensions instead of just two, the Blackhawks will indeed be down..
